Given that football is not a solo sporting activity, it teaches players the art of working as a team. Additionally, among the vital benefits of football training is the fact that it requires synergy, cooperation and communication. Eventually, having the ability to successfully interact with others, provide support to your teammates and partner with others towards a shared goal is a life skill that you will need to use and employ across a variety of different situations and contexts, whether it's in the school room or work environment.

It is unsurprising that football is such a popular sport to play, especially when you think about the many benefits of playing football. For a start, football is extremely excellent exercise. Whether you are dribbling, scoring or tackling etc., you are exerting a great deal of physical activity which gets your heart check here pounding and blood streaming. Not only does this develop your endurance and speed, however it also enhances your heart health, blood pressure and aerobic capacity, while all at once increasing muscle mass, strengthening bones and decreasing body fat. Inevitably, among the major positives of football is that it keeps you fit, active and healthy but in a very enjoyable manner, especially in comparison to running on a treadmill. It is vital to keep in mind that these health advantages also extend to individuals's mental health also. As an example, running around a football pitch triggers the release of endorphins in your brain, which are otherwise known as the 'happy hormone'. To put it simply, playing football can actually boost people's mental health and make them feel a lot more energised for the rest of the day.
